If ghosts did truly haunt the halls of Castle MacArron, they likely roamed aimlessly, lost amongst the sprawling labyrinth of chambers and corridors of the centuries-old stronghold. Days after sheâd arrived, Leana was still learning the layout of the place. Fortunately, most of the familyâs activities were confined to several rooms which were meticulously maintained to Mrs. Davidsonâs exacting standards.
Leana peered up at the portrait of James MacArronâs pirate ancestor, the dashing privateer whoâd used the strategies and daring heâd honed as a pirate to earn a knighthood for his service to the crown. Tall and lean, possessing a chiseled jaw and a firm, sensuous mouth, Captain Seamus MacDougall had posed for his portrait with a sgian dubh tucked into his hose and a cutlass in his hand. A look of arrogance played on his lips, a boldness in his posture, both traits captured to perfection by the artist. MacDougallâs hair had been a shade or two lighter than his great-grandsonâs, a fine golden hue, and his intriguing eyes were more blue than green. Still, the resemblance between the men was undeniable.
Her mind wandered to thoughts of James MacArron. Sheâd been foolish to challenge the man. What in heaven had she been thinking, insinuating heâd been bested by his younger brotherâand with her help, no less?
Heâd certainly shown her whatâs what when he asked her to dance. Moving across the floor with one warm, strong hand at her waist and the other gently clasping hers, sheâd lost herself in his arms. At least for a moment. Perhaps two. What would it be like to dance with the man while an orchestra played, to feel at home in his arms as he held her, night after night? Morning after passionate morning?
Ye dinna know meânor what I am capable of.
Heâd murmured the words against her ear, his warm breath a wisp against her lobe. Had he issued a warning? Or a challenge?
Ah, what a delicious challenge that would be.
A little sigh escaped her. Pity she could not soothe her heartâs longing. Sheâd know better next time. Sheâd protect herself and steel her heart. There was no place in her life for a dalliance with a manâany man, much less the handsome pirate who expected proper dignity and decorum from the woman heâd entrusted with his bairns.
Pulling in a breath to shore up her courage, she continued along the shadowed corridor. Portraits of Scots whoâd lived centuries before sheâd taken her first breath gazed down at her. Coming to a room sheâd yet to explore, she tested the door. The hinges squealed as the stout panel swung open. What would she find in the dimly lit space? Would cobwebs drape the corners of the ceiling and a phantom or two peek out from their hiding places? She smiled to herself. My, she was becoming fanciful. It wasnât like her to let a childâs imaginative fears get to her.
